#2c65c5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2c65c5 is composed of 17.3% red, 39.6% green and 77.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.7% cyan, 48.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 217.6 degrees, a saturation of 63.5% and a lightness of 47.3%. #2c65c5 color hex could be obtained by blending #58caff with #00008b.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

Shades and Tints of #2c65c5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010205 is the darkest color, while #f4f7fc is the lightest one.
